How to move the crop rectangle in a source image, when filling a panel ( with cropping ) ?

I tried drag, alt-drag, shift-drag, control-drag : I cannot find how to move the image within the panel. The panel moves.

Similar to the Crop transformation, the cropping rectangle is displayed as an overlay on the input image in the main image area. Set the Layout transformation display toolbar to show the input image (gray circle) and click on the panel or the input thumbnail in the image browser to select a specific image for display.
